Why Minimal Desk Setups Work
A minimalist workspace offers several benefits:
- Reduces visual distractions
- Improves focus and concentration
- Makes cleaning and maintenance easier
- Creates a more professional appearance
- Encourages intentional purchasing decisions
- Supports better workflow organization
Many professionals find that a cleaner workspace helps them stay focused for longer periods and reduces mental fatigue during demanding tasks.
Essential Elements of a Great Minimal Desk Setup
1. A Clean Desk Surface
The foundation of every minimal setup is a clutter-free workspace. Limit visible items to the tools you use every day.
2. Proper Lighting
Lighting dramatically affects both productivity and aesthetics. Consider monitor light bars, desk lamps, or indirect ambient lighting.
3. Cable Management
Hidden cables instantly make a setup look more professional. Cable trays, sleeves, and adhesive clips are inexpensive upgrades that make a significant difference.
4. Ergonomic Positioning
Your monitor should be positioned at eye level, and your keyboard and mouse should allow for a comfortable wrist position.
5. Consistent Color Theme
The best minimal setups usually follow one of these themes:
- White and silver
- Black and gray
- Natural wood and neutral tones
- Monochrome workspaces

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Buying Too Many Accessories
Minimalism is about intentional choices, not collecting every desk gadget available.
Ignoring Ergonomics
A beautiful workspace is useless if it causes discomfort after several hours of use.
Poor Lighting
Lighting is often overlooked despite being one of the most important elements of a productive workspace.
Lack of Storage
Hidden storage solutions help maintain a clean desk surface while keeping essential items accessible.
